Trump imposes sanctions on Iran; EU not pleased
Tuesday, August 7, 2018
WASHINGTON -- The United States reimposed stiff economic sanctions Monday on Iran, ratcheting up pressure on the Islamic Republic despite statements of deep dismay from European allies, three months after President Donald Trump pulled the U.S. out of the international accord limiting Iran's nuclear activities.
